1

我已经阅读了 JSON-LD 和 JSON-LD-API 的文档和规范(并且可能错过了一些东西)。

我发现对象节点的本地上下文可以通过将“@context: [.., .., ...]”定义为多个上下文定义的数组来组成(其中一些可能是内联的,另一些可能是外部的参考)。我还发现引用“外部上下文”假定相应的 IRI 引用解析为 JSON-LD 文档,在其根对象节点中具有预期的 @context 定义,该定义将用于代替对“外部上下文”的原始引用”。

我的问题是:远程 JSON-LD 文档中引用的@context 是否有效(或合理,或暗示)也可能是复合的(就像普通的本地 @context),或者是限制为被引用的外部上下文一个明确的上下文实体(即本地 XOR 外部定义,即不是许多上下文定义的数组)?

(这个问题可能是针对 JSON-LD 标准的作者)。

4

1 回答 1

1

远程上下文不受任何限制,这意味着它可以包含对其他上下文的引用。

于 2014-11-22T19:57:44.723 回答